Bohdan Khmelnytskyi Monument

In the city of Khmelnyts’kyi there is a monument to the eminent Ukrainian hetman Bohdan Khmelnitsky. The monument was erected in honour of the great general, great strategist and tactician, who had led a national uprising of the Ukrainian people against Polish oppression.

The monument to Bohdan Khmelnyts’kyi was opened September 28, 1993 to celebrate the 500th anniversary of the city founding. Under the project of the sculptor Valentine Borysenko and the architect Michael Kopyla the monument to hetman was placed at the intersection of Kamenets’ka and Gagarina Streets. You’ll see Bohdan Khmelnyts’kyi on the horseback holding the reins in his left hand, and the mace in his right hand raising this symbol of power high in the air. The monument is made of bronze and is located on the trapezoidal pedestal.

Equestrian monument dedicated to Bohdan Khmelnyts’kyi is a symbol of the city.
